Two particles A and B of masses m and 2m are moving along the X-axis and Y-axis respectively with the same speed v. They collide at the origin and coalesce into one body, after the collision. What is the velocity of this coalesced mass? What is the loss of energy during this collision?

Figure shows particles A and B before collision and Figure the coalesced mass after collision.
In figure, we have taken velocity of combinedmass (3m) as `vecV` making an angle `alpha` with positive X-axis.
Using law of conservation of linear momentum
(i) along X-axis
`mv=3mVcosalpha` ...(i)
(ii) along Y-axis
`2mv=3mVsinalpha` ...(ii)
Dividing (ii) by (i), we get
`2=tanalpha or alpha = tan^(-1)(2)=63.4^(@)`
Squaring (i) and (ii) and adding, we get
`(3mV)^(2)(cos^(2)alpha+sin^(2)alpha)=m^(2)v^(2)+m^(2)v^(2)`
`=5m^(2)v^(2)`
`V^(2)=(5)/(9)v^(2)or V=(sqrt(5))/(3)v`
No, total K.E.before collision,
`K_(1)=(1)/(2)mv^(2)+(1)/(2)(2m)v^(2)=(3)/(2)mv^(2)`
total K.E. after collision,
`K_(2)=(1)/(2)(3m)V^(2)=(1)/(2)(3m)(5)/(9)v^(2)=(5)/(6)mv^(2)`
Loss of K.E. during the collision,
`DeltaK=K_(1)-K_(2)`
` DeltaK=(3)/(2)mv^(2)-(5)/(6)mv^(2)=(2)/(3)mv^(2)`
